UNEXPECTED VOLATILE COMPOUNDS OF MYRTUS COMMUNIS L. FRUIT RIND GROWING IN IRAN

The hydrodistilled essential oil of the rind of Myrtus communis L. fruit cultivated in the north of Iran, was analyzed by gas chromatography (GC) and gas chromatography–mass spectrometry (GC–MS). Fifteen compounds constituting 98.6% of the total oil were identified. The main components were (E)-9-Octadecenoic acid (18.5%), γ-Terpinene (11.3%), (E)-4-Decenal (10.9%), cis-4-Decen-1-ol (10.0%), Oleic acid (8.6%) and α-Terpineol (7.6%). The literature survey revealed that volatile constituents of different parts of Myrtus communis L. have been extensively reported but the essential oil of the fruit rind has not been chemically investigated and this article is the first study on the chemical composition of this part
